Description

Job purpose:
To provide administrative support for clergy, and be a part of the administrative team of the synagogue.

Overview of Main Responsibilities

Clergy Support
Manage Clergy calendars
Assist Clergy with written communications
Update member information related to the responsibilities supported by the Clergy Assistant (e.g., recording births and deaths).
Provide administrative support to the clergy
Provide support for life-cycle events (e.g., weddings, births, funerals, etc.)
Manage all Yahrzeit functions

Communications
Layout, design and production of congregational announcements
Content collection and production of various written materials
Assist with the online delivery of various programming (e.g., supporting virtual worship logistics, zoom links, etc.

Programs
Provide logistical and administrative support for synagogue programs and events as assigned
Create visual T'fillah in power point
Support the B’nei Mitzvah program by preparing B’nei Mitzvah certificates, the B’nei mitzvah tzedakah program B’nei Mitzvah scheduling.
Recruit, assign and support volunteers for specific programs

Front Office
Support the front desk as needed during breaks and absences
As part of the Administrative team, staff part of the High Holy Day program and Gala event.

Education, training and experience
Two years office experience

Knowledge/skills
Demonstrates excellent communication skills and sensitivity in working with people.
Excellent oral and written skills.
Computer expertise and demonstrated proficiency with Microsoft Office Suite, Adobe or In-design, basic database management, internet and social networking.
Must maintain strict confidentiality.
Ability to effectively manage multiple tasks, and prioritize demands.
Flexible, able to meet changing work needs and demands
Excellent organizational skills
Familiarity with Jewish customs and rituals, synagogue life. The ability to read Hebrew is desirable.
Plans and utilizes time effectively and independently
Ability to work collaboratively with staff and synagogue volunteers.
A sense of humor and a passion for learning are essential
Approaches challenges with creativity and equanimity
